#e53d45 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e53d45 is composed of 89.8% red, 23.9%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.4% magenta, 69.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 357.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 56.9%. #e53d45 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7a8a with #cb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#e53d45 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e53d45 has RGB values of R:229, G:61,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.7,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15023429.

Shades and Tints of #e53d45
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0202 is the darkest color, while #fffb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e53d45
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99898a is the less saturated color, while #fe242e is the most saturated one.
